## FeedCheck Validator — Operational Notes

Validates podcast feeds on ingest for the Hollowpine platform. Rejects malformed enclosures, oversized artwork, and duplicate GUIDs. Failures land in the quarantine queue; retries are capped at three. Review changes to rejection rules carefully — downstream publishers depend on them. Runtime limits and queue endpoints are set by the configuration values that follow.

deployment values, yahag-tawef:
ZORWYN_HOST=zorwyn.tolvaqlabs.internal
ZORWYN_PORT=9300

## Changelog — Ticktrace 1.9

### Renamed: DRIFT_API_TOKEN
During the cron drift investigation we found plugins confusing this variable with the metrics token, so it has been renamed to indicate it authorizes drift-report uploads specifically. Plugin authors must read the new name from 1.9 onward; the old name is ignored without warning. Sample env files in the SDK are updated. In your deployment env file, the drift-report upload secret is set on the next line.

env line for fawef-taguf: VAULT_KEY13=a9695905a9a90

# Greywater Environments

Quick map for anyone chasing the query planner regression: prod, staging, and the `plannerlab` sandbox all run Greywater's optimizer, but only plannerlab has the new cost model enabled. If plans look weird, check which environment you're actually hitting before panicking — it's usually staging lagging a build. The staging instance currently runs with these configuration values.

settings of fafog-haduf:
ZORIX_PIN=4648
ZORIX_METRICS_HOST=metrics.zorix.paliqsys.corp
ZORIX_LOG_LEVEL=info
ZORIX_TENANT=druix

Subject: On-call handover — Meadowcart catalog cache

Hi — handing over the Meadowcart catalog caching work. The invalidation path from Shelfsync to the edge cache is currently dual-writing: both the legacy purge queue and the new event stream fire on every product update. Keep it that way until the stream proves reliable for a full week; we saw dropped events last Tuesday. If you see stale prices, purge manually via the Shelfsync console first. Questions after my rotation ends should go to the catalog platform inbox.

escalation mailbox, bafog-fafog: ulador@paliqlabs.internal